Parents' attitudes to education

18/05/2009

Research carried out by Edge found that parents in the UK believe that secondary school is not working for 28% of children, supporting Edge’s campaign for a radical overhaul of the education.

The survey included over 1000 parents with children aged 11-16 currently in the education system.

Findings paint a concerning picture- 26% of mums and dads often worry that their child is not happy and 42% claim that only academically minded children do well at school.
